Wired Xbox 360 controller for Windows 7 computer?
-
How do I set it up? I've already put it into the Laptops USB port but all it does it make a noise and nothing happens, the X in the middle of the controller lights up as if it were connected to the 360, but I cannot move the mouse with it.
-
Answer:
you need to have a driver to make the Xbox360 usb cord to control things. you should either purchase a "microsoft Xbox360 for windows" or download a driver. i've proved link to drivers for either 32bit or 64bit windows 7 editions.
